Le Mobilien: Parisian Bus Rapid Transit

29 September 2008 - 2:00pm

Paris has invested big in Le Mobilien, its version of Bus Rapid Transit. Streetsblog has a short video profiling the system.

"Le Mobilien features curbside and onboard bus arrival info, mid-street boarding kiosks, a swipe-card payment system, and -- perhaps most crucial to its success -- lanes that are physically separated from car traffic."
